IRAN
Irans Forex Reserves Stand At $100Bn
Irans foreign exchange reserves stand at $100bn, the Minister of Economic Affairs and Finance Shamsodin Hosseini told reporters in Washington on 17 April. The minister estimated the countrys foreign debt at $20bn, according to Mehr News Agency.
